Folks,

 

Anyone know of any decent restaurants that will be open on Christmas Day in Sheffield?

 

I notice that the Walnut Club in Hathersage does. Anywhere else?

 

Cheers

 

Yes, the samuel fox in Bradwell (not far from Hathersage) is also open for christmas day lunch. I got a brochure put on my desk at work. Been once before and really enjoyed it so a good tip I think. If I could get out of my family christmas, I would be there.
